TriOptima record compression shrinks notional in Eurex clearing

Related Topics

TriOptima, an infrastructure service that lowers costs and mitigates risk in OTC derivatives markets, has reduced notional outstanding at Eurex Clearing by 26 per cent following a record compression run on 26 June, 2019.

The latest run, which equates to USD3.9 trillion worth of cleared euro interest rate swaps (IRS) and Forward Rate Agreements (FRAs), represents a 143 per cent increase on the previous record of USD1.6 trillion.

The record comes as market participants continue to utilise TriOptima’s triReduce service to cut their gross notional exposure. By eliminating transactions through triReduce in a clearing house environment, firms go one step further to meeting regulatory demands of reducing systemic risk across the global financial markets.
